Why Is Stability Essential for Runners When Choosing an Ankle Sleeve?

Stability is essential for runners when choosing an ankle sleeve because it helps prevent injuries, improves performance, and enhances comfort during runs. Proper stability from an ankle sleeve ensures that the ankle joint maintains its range of motion while reducing the risk of sprains and strains.

According to the American Orthopaedic Foot & Ankle Society, a reputable organization in orthopedic medicine, stability refers to the ability of a joint to maintain proper alignment and function during movement. Stability is particularly important for runners whose activities involve constant changes in direction and impact on the ankles.

The underlying causes for the need for stability in ankle sleeves arise from the physical demands of running. When a runner’s foot strikes the ground, forces are transmitted through the ankle joint. Without adequate support, these forces can lead to excessive movement and strain on the ligaments. Ligaments are the fibrous tissues that connect bones at a joint. Ankle sleeves provide compression, which helps to stabilize these ligaments and prevent unnecessary lateral movements that can cause injury.

Technical terms related to ankle stability include proprioception and tensile strength. Proprioception is the body’s ability to sense its position in space. Improved proprioception through the use of a well-designed ankle sleeve enhances the runner’s awareness of the ankle’s position, thus aiding in better balance and coordination. Tensile strength refers to the ability of the sleeve material to withstand tension without stretching excessively. A sleeve with high tensile strength supports the ankle effectively during runs.

The mechanisms behind the benefits of an ankle sleeve involve compression and support. Compression increases circulation in the area, which can help reduce swelling and promote quicker recovery. Support from the sleeve limits the range of motion of the ankle, protecting against overstretching during dynamic activities such as running.

Specific conditions that make stability vital for runners include a history of ankle sprains, weak ankle muscles, and flat feet. Runners who have previously injured their ankles may have lingering instability, making them more susceptible to future injuries. For example, running on uneven terrains increases the risk of rolling an ankle. Wearing an appropriately chosen ankle sleeve can significantly mitigate this risk by stabilizing the joint during such activities.

What Should You Look for in the Best Ankle Sleeve for Stability and Support?

To find the best ankle sleeve for stability and support, look for features such as material, fit, compression, design, and moisture-wicking properties.

  1. Material
  2. Fit
  3. Compression Level
  4. Design
  5. Moisture-Wicking Properties

Considering these attributes can help you select the right ankle sleeve for your needs.

  1. Material:
    The material of an ankle sleeve significantly affects its performance and comfort. Common materials include neoprene, nylon, and spandex. Neoprene provides warmth and support but can be bulky. Nylon and spandex offer a lightweight option, promoting mobility while still offering elasticity. According to a study conducted by Dr. Mary Johnson in 2022, neoprene can enhance stability but may trap heat, leading to discomfort during extended use.

  2. Fit:
    The fit of an ankle sleeve is crucial for effectiveness. A snug fit ensures stability without restricting blood flow. It is important to check the sizing guide from manufacturers, as sizes can vary. An ill-fitting sleeve can create discomfort or fail to provide necessary support. A survey by the American Orthopedic Society highlighted that 68% of users experienced improved stability when using properly sized sleeves.

  3. Compression Level:
    Compression in ankle sleeves promotes blood flow and can reduce swelling. Options typically range from mild to firm compression. Stronger compression offers better support for injuries but may not be suitable for all users. A study by Dr. Emily Wang in 2021 indicated that adequate compression improved athletic performance and reduced recovery times.

  4. Design:
    Design elements such as open-heel or closed-heel options cater to different needs. Open-heel designs allow for a greater range of motion, while closed-heel styles provide additional support. A user preference study from Grey Research revealed that 75% of athletes preferred open designs for comfort during activities.

  5. Moisture-Wicking Properties:
    Moisture-wicking properties in the material help to keep the skin dry and comfortable. This feature is especially beneficial during intense activities where sweat levels are high. According to research by the Journal of Sports Sciences in 2020, fabrics that effectively wick moisture enhance comfort and performance, ultimately aiding in user satisfaction during physical activities.

How Do Materials Impact the Effectiveness of Ankle Sleeves for Runners?

Materials significantly impact the effectiveness of ankle sleeves for runners by influencing comfort, support, moisture-wicking capabilities, and protection against injury.

Comfort: The choice of material affects how an ankle sleeve feels against the skin. Soft, breathable fabrics enhance comfort during long runs. Studies indicate that runners prefer compression materials like nylon and spandex due to their stretch and comfort (Smith & Johnson, 2022).

Support: Different materials provide varying levels of support. Neoprene, for example, offers good support and warmth, which can be crucial for individuals recovering from injuries. Research shows that neoprene sleeves improve ankle stability and reduce the risk of sprains (Williams et al., 2021).

Moisture-wicking capabilities: Ankle sleeves made from moisture-wicking materials help to keep the skin dry by drawing sweat away from the body. This feature reduces the risk of chafing and irritation. A study by Lee (2020) found that polyester-based fabrics were most effective at moisture management, which is essential for enhancing performance during runs.

Protection against injury: High-quality materials can provide additional protection against external impacts and abrasions. Kevlar and other high-durability materials can offer increased resilience. Evidence suggests that runners using reinforced sleeves experienced fewer injuries related to impacts and friction (Brown et al., 2023).

Breathability: Ankle sleeves with breathable materials promote air circulation, preventing overheating during intense activity. Fabrics such as mesh contribute to ventilation, which helps maintain a comfortable temperature. A study by Martinez (2021) highlighted that breathable sleeves are preferred by runners, as they improve overall comfort during extended use.
